Start with Licensing and Operator Reputation

A valid gambling licence is the first meaningful quality signal. Regulated operators are generally required to protect player funds, verify identities, publish terms, and use approved testing procedures. Check the footer of the casino website for the regulator’s name, licence number, and legal company details. Then confirm those credentials through the regulator’s public register whenever possible.

Reputation also deserves careful examination. Look for consistent feedback across independent review platforms, focusing on withdrawal delays, account closures, disputed promotions, and support quality. A few negative comments are not automatically decisive, but repeated complaints about the same issue should be treated as a warning. Avoid sites that hide ownership information, use unrealistic promises, or pressure visitors to deposit immediately.

Compare Games, Fairness, and Mobile Performance

A credible casino should provide transparent information about its game portfolio. Popular categories include slots, table games, live dealer titles, jackpots, and specialty games. Variety is useful, but the presence of familiar suppliers and independently audited random number generators is more important than the number of available titles.

Return-to-player figures can help compare games over a large number of theoretical rounds, but they do not predict a short session. Volatility matters too: high-volatility games may produce larger but less frequent wins, while lower-volatility titles often distribute smaller outcomes more regularly. Neither option removes the house edge.

Read Bonuses and Banking Terms Before Depositing

A welcome offer should be assessed as a contract, not a headline. Read the minimum deposit, wagering multiplier, eligible games, maximum bet, expiry period, contribution rates, and maximum withdrawal rules. Some promotions exclude bonus funds from cash withdrawals or impose unusually restrictive conditions. If the terms are difficult to find or written ambiguously, choose a more transparent operator.

  • Confirm whether the offer is available in your jurisdiction.
  • Check wagering requirements for both the deposit and bonus amount.
  • Review payment fees, processing times, and minimum withdrawal limits.
  • Verify whether identity checks are required before withdrawing.
  • Use a payment method registered in your own name.

Banking quality is often more important than promotional value. Established casinos commonly support bank cards, electronic wallets, bank transfers, and sometimes locally recognised methods. Deposits may be instant, while withdrawals can take longer because of verification and manual review. A casino that clearly explains these stages is more trustworthy than one advertising instant payouts without practical detail.

Build a Responsible Playing Plan

Online gambling should be treated as paid entertainment, never as a dependable income source. Set a spending limit before opening a session and keep gambling funds separate from money needed for rent, bills, savings, or debt repayments. A time limit is equally useful because extended play can make losses feel less significant than they are.

Responsible operators normally offer deposit limits, loss limits, reality checks, cooling-off periods, and self-exclusion. Use these tools before problems arise. Avoid chasing losses, increasing stakes to recover a setback, or borrowing money to continue playing. If gambling begins to affect sleep, relationships, work, or financial stability, stop and seek support from an appropriate local service.
